The Opportunity

Reporting to the General Manager, you will be responsible for the efficient and cost-effective management of production and supply, ensuring products are manufactured to customer requirements and delivered within agreed timeframes. Key responsibilities include leading and developing the production team and day-to-day manufacturing operations; driving continuous improvement and optimizing processes.

Key Responsibilities

  • Leading and developing the production team and day-to-day manufacturing operations
  • Driving continuous improvement and process optimization
  • Ensuring products are manufactured to customer requirements and delivered on time
  • Managing costs and ensuring efficient use of resources
  • Collaborating with cross-functional teams to meet production goals

What We're Looking For

  • Proven experience in a similar role within the manufacturing industry
  • A strong understanding of production processes and supply chain management
  • Leadership skills with the ability to develop and motivate teams
  • Excellent problem-solving and decision-making abilities
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ite and relevant project management tools

    About this role & career path

    This role sits in industrial production management (O*NET 11-3051.00). Core work is directing production and quality systems, resolving process problems, and leading people. Related titles include Industrial Production Manager, Area Plant Manager, and Assembly Manager.

    Typical work in Production Manager

    Independent occupational context from O*NET (U.S. public-domain labor data). This is about the occupation, not a rewrite of this employer's posting.

    • Set and monitor product standards, examining samples of raw products or directing testing during processing, to ensure finished products are of prescribed quality.
    • Direct or coordinate production, processing, distribution, or marketing activities of industrial organizations.
    • Review processing schedules or production orders to make decisions concerning inventory requirements, staffing requirements, work procedures, or duty assignments, considering budgetary limitations and time constraints.
    • Review operations and confer with technical or administrative staff to resolve production or processing problems.
    • Hire, train, evaluate, or discharge staff or resolve personnel grievances.
    • Develop or implement production tracking or quality control systems, analyzing production, quality control, maintenance, or other operational reports to detect production problems.
